RH6 9UG is a sought-after residential area on Grassmere, 1.0km from Horley in Horley (Reigate and Banstead). Administratively it sits within Horley East & Salfords ward and the East Surrey constituency.

One of the more sought-after postcodes in RH6, RH6 9UG offers a culturally diverse area with a strong community identity. During the day, ethnically mixed self-employed professional services, home workers in outer suburbs. A balanced community with an average age of 44 — families, professionals, and long-term residents all well represented. 92% of residents own their home — above average for the district, consistent with a stable and sought-after address.

Safety: Crime rates are low here at 14 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Average house prices are around £352k, up 4.4% year-on-year. The area ranks among the least deprived 20% in England — a strong signal of community wellbeing, good schools, and low crime.

Census 2021 statistics for RH6 9UG are sourced from Output Area E00155976 (shared with 6 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
